The rising frequency of violence against women in public spaces demands the design of sophisticated early intervention systems capable of detecting and mitigating threats in real time. This study introduces WATCHGUARD, a novel surveillance platform powered by artificial intelligence, which merges cutting-edge computer vision techniques and deep learning to enhance the safety of women in urban surroundings. The architecture adopts a multi-modal design: YOLOv8 performs object detection, the OpenAI CLIP model conducts semantic validation of actions, and a suite of custom neural networks executes gesture recognition and gender classification. Our experimental framework analyzes continuous video streams to detect dangerous objects, recognize distress signals, and automate alerts to law enforcement. The prototype achieves 94.2% accuracy in overall threat identification, 91.8% precision in gender classification, and 89.5% performance in gesture recognition, while sustaining a low false-positive rate of 3.2%. Validation across varied urban contexts demonstrates the ability to recognize threat manifestations, including physical assaults, weapon-mediated attacks, and standardized emergency gestures. Privacy is safeguarded through robust data anonymization protocols, and the architecture is designed for seamless integration within existing smart city infrastructures. The findings demonstrate substantial decreases in response times accompanied by heightened situational awareness among security staff, establishing this system as a feasible and proactive measure for advancing women's safety in urban environments.

This study critically examines the interplay of time, cost, and resource allocation in the creation of a smart commercial complex in an urban Tier-2 city in India. It explores the challenges posed by infrastructure constraints, regulatory delays, and fluctuating market conditions, while highlighting opportunities such as lower land costs and increasing demand for smart infrastructure. Using the 3M/4M framework--Man, Machine, Material, and Money--the research analyses project phases from initiation to termination, applying tools like Gantt charts, CPM, and Earned Value Management for monitoring and control. The findings emphasise that strategic planning, effective resource synchronisation, and risk-based procurement are essential for timely, cost-efficient, and quality-driven project delivery in such emerging urban environments.

This study investigates the connection between teenage sports activity and self-esteem. Self-esteem, a vital component of psychological development, is influenced by various social and physical factors during adolescence. Sports participation has been identified as a key contributor to enhancing self-esteem through improvements in physical competence, social interaction, and the development of life skills. The research reviews empirical evidence demonstrating that adolescents involved in regular sports activities report higher levels of self-esteem compared to their non-participating peers. Furthermore, the quality of sports experiences, including supportive coaching and a positive social environment, plays a crucial role in maximizing these benefits. However, the study also acknowledges that negative experiences in sports, such as excessive pressure or exclusion, may undermine self-esteem. Overall, fostering inclusive and supportive sports environments is essential for promoting healthy self-esteem development in adolescents.

Complex odontomas arising in the posterior maxilla are uncommon, and extension into the maxillary sinus can mimic chronic sinus disease. Early recognition and appropriate surgical management are crucial to prevent recurrent sinus pathology and facial discomfort. A 14-year-old male presented with a chief complaint of proclined maxillary anterior teeth. Radiographic evaluation using orthopantomograph, lateral cephalogram, and cone-beam computed tomography revealed a large, well-defined radiopaque mass with a thin radiolucent rim in the right posterior maxilla, extending into the maxillary sinus and associated with an impacted second molar. The provisional diagnosis of a complex odontoma was made. Under general anaesthesia, surgical excision of the lesion was performed using a piecemeal approach due to its size and relation to adjacent structures, followed by removal of the impacted tooth. A minor discontinuity in the sinus lining was repaired with a collagen membrane. Postoperative healing was uneventful, and histopathological analysis confirmed the diagnosis of complex odontoma. The patient was subsequently rehabilitated to restore masticatory function and maintain occlusal stability. This case emphasizes the significance of timely diagnosis, meticulous surgical intervention, and interdisciplinary management in treating large odontomas involving the maxillary sinus.

Exact similarity solution for the viscous flow due to stretching surface in the presence of magnetic field is derived. Adopting the similarity transformation, governing nonlinear partial differential equations of the problem are transformed to nonlinear ordinary differential equations. Then the numerical solution of the problem is derived using Quasilinearization of Newton's method. Two cases of heat transfer are considered. The sheet (a) with prescribed surface temperature and (b) the prescribed wall heat flux .both the cases are further extended to study the heat transfer due to suction and injection. A simple relation for the two cases of heat transfer is obtained.

ABSTRACT Shear walls are key elements in tall buildings for resisting earthquake loads, with lateral beams often connecting them to enhance ductility. Earthquake-induced dynamic loads are a major cause of building damage, making it essential to understand a structure's dynamic characteristics. Asymmetric tall buildings, combining frames, shear walls, and cores, often face torsional effects from lateral forces such as wind, seismic action, and uneven settlement. This study uses the Response Spectrum Method in ETABS to analyse a vertically unsymmetrical structure with varying shear wall locations. The objective is to reduce torsion through four concentric shear wall configurations.
